Now and then you buy something that works as advertised with no fuss. My Mazda 3's plastic headlight lenses were completely clouded and opaque - although the light shone through OK you could not see the individual light clusters behind the lens. I bought this at Lowes for IIRC around $25 but I looked it up on Amazon for this note and it's $13 with free shipment if you have Prime.

It's basically a sanding kit with a drill attachment and 500, 800 and 3200 grit discs and an abrasive paste. Tape off the body work and it takes about half an hour to do two front lenses. Crystal clear; no muss, no fuss. It does what it says on the box which is unusual these days.
